Responsibilities
- Manage medication use including compounding, preparation, selection, dispensing, storage and stocking of medications for the entire organization.
- Develop and conduct medication use evaluations as needed, and report results to the relevant committees or subcommittees to implement in daily practice.
- Design, implement, and lead pharmacy process improvement initiatives, including those focused on evidenced based care, safety, financial sustainability or quality improvement processes.
- Performs other duties as assigned
- Collaborate with pharmacy team to ensure provision of optimal patient care.
